Transaction 51a8c37f417adb8d34d667fd3706ee91c2ec94105dc6da56121a8796ca44689c

1 Input
2 Outputs
  • 51a8c37f417adb8d34d667fd3706ee91c2ec94105dc6da56121a8796ca44689c:0
  • value  35541
    address  18vHgc9KgeuaQmNhSEKQXa6oQcudbcRMUP
  • 51a8c37f417adb8d34d667fd3706ee91c2ec94105dc6da56121a8796ca44689c:1
  • value  11710000
    address  1FCVGgKLVLQqcScQrGa6jPjyjDgQKRL9G3